Las mayores velocidades se alcanzaron en los lanzamientos en los que hay desplazamiento previo.Abstract: The aim of this study was two fold, first to determine the body composition, physical and conditional characteristics of male handball players, who were playing in juvenile level in Murcia. A Second objective was to establish differences among the teams evaluated and offensive playing lines. The teams analyzed were playing in Murcia, Alhama, Jumilla and Águilas. 45 juvenile male handball players participated in this study. Anthropometric data were collected following ISAK protocols. A descriptive statistical analysis was made in order to obtains means and standard deviation of the simple. An ANOVA analysis was performed in order to establish differences among teams and its playing lines. The somatotype, throwing velocity and grip were analyzed in all teams The best teams show higher values in anthropometric variables than the worts, but these differences does not reach statistical significance. Mesomorphy is a very important characteristic in handball player. Higher throwing velocities were reach in throwings with previous displacements.

Objective: To analyze the frequency of implementation of bariatric surgery (CB) performed in "Brazil" between the years "2011 to 2019", that is, nine (09) years. Method: Exploratory, descriptive study with a quantitative approach. The data were extracted from the Brazilian Society of Bariatric and Metabolic Surgery (SBCBM). Descriptive statistical analysis was implemented. The results were presented using explanatory tables and graphs. Results: The universa of 493.212 CB performed was identified, with a mean and standard deviation of (54,801±11,300.2). The year 2019 registered the highest preponderance with 13.9% (n=68.530) and 2011 registered the lowest preponderance with 7% (n=34.629). 79.9% (n=394.101) CB were financed by Health Plans, 15.3% (n=75.624) by SUS and 4.8% (n=23.487) by private institutions. Final considerations: There was an increase in the frequency of CB records made in the analyzed geographical and historical section. Descriptors: Obesity; Morbid obesity; Bariatric surgery.

Statistics today represent a group of scientific methods for the quantitative and qualitative investigation of variations in mass appearances. In fact, statistics present a group of methods that are used for the accumulation, analysis, presentation and interpretation of data necessary for reaching certain conclusions. Statistical analysis is divided into descriptive statistical analysis and inferential statistics. The values which represent the results of an experiment, and which are the subject of observation of a certain occurrence, are called parameters and they are divided into descriptive and numerical. All numerical parameters are divided into non-continuous and continuous. The graphic presentation of the distribution of frequencies can be by poligon or histogram. The most frequently applied descriptive statistical methods are: arithmetic mean, standard deviation, standard error of arithmetic mean, variation coefficient, and variation interval.

Ascorbic acid is a water-soluble vitamin provided with strong antioxidant action, that fulfills an important immune protective role of the body against infections and prevents various cancers appearance. The main goal of this study was to exactly quantify pure ascorbic acid in tablets of two pharmaceuticals. Proposed objective consisted in improvement and application of a iodometric titration method in ascorbic acid quantitative analysis. Ascorbic acid content per tablet in both studied pharmaceuticals was 173.84 mg, very close to official stated amount of active substance (180 mg). Allowed percentage deviation from declared content of pure ascorbic acid was only 3.42 %, below maximum value of � 5 % imposed by Romanian Pharmacopoeia 10-th Edition, according to European and International standards. Statistical analysis confirmed experimental obtained results and revealed low Standard Error value SE = 0.214476, which has fallen within normal limits. Confidence Level value (95.0 %) = 0.551328 and Standard Deviation SD = 0.525357. were within normal range of values. Relative Standard Deviation (Coefficient of variation or homogeneity) RSD = 26.268% was found below maximum range of accepted values (30-35%). P value = 7.44. 10-6 was located within normal limits, P [ 0.001, so the experimental obtained results has shown highest statistical significance. Thus, studied titration method can be successfully used in quantitative analysis of ascorbic acid from different samples.

To study the relationship between health and nutritional status in elderly populations, information about body composition is essential. To collect this information in large epidemiological studies, practical methods based on anthropometric data must be available. In the present study the relationship between body composition, determined by densitometry, and anthropometric data in 204 elderly men and women, aged 60–87 years, was analysed. Existing prediction equations described in the literature, and mainly based on young and middle-aged subjects, generally underestimated percentage body fat in the elderly study population. Therefore, new prediction equations were developed, based on sex and the sum of two (biceps and triceps) or four (biceps, triceps, suprailiaca and subscapula) skinfolds or the body mass index (BMI). Addition of age or body circumferences to the models did not improve the prediction of body density. Internal cross validation and external validation revealed that the formulas are valid for the estimation of body density in elderly subjects. The standard errors of estimate of the three models, expressed as percentage body fat, were 5.6, 5.4 and 4.8% respectively.

Flat jockeys in Great Britain (GB) are classified as apprentices if they are aged less than 26 years and/or have ridden less than 95 winners. To gain experience, apprentices are allocated a weight allowance of up to 7 lb (3.2 kg). Given that there is no off-season in GB flat horseracing, jockeys are required to maintain their racing weight all year round. In light of recent work determining that current apprentices are considerably heavier than previous generations and that smaller increases have been made in the minimum weight, the aim of this study was to assess if the minimum weight in GB was achievable. To make the minimum weight (50.8 kg) with the maximal weight allowance requires a body mass of ∼46.6 kg while maintaining a fat mass >2.5 kg (the lowest fat mass previously reported in weight-restricted males). Thirty-two male apprentice jockeys were assessed for body composition using dual-energy X-ray absorptiometry. The mean (SD) total mass and fat mass were 56 (2.9) kg and 7.2 (1.8) kg, respectively. Given that the lowest theoretical body mass for this group was 51.2 (2.3) kg, only one of 32 jockeys was deemed feasible to achieve the minimum weight with their current weight allowance and maintaining fat mass >2.5 kg. Furthermore, urine osmolality of 780 (260) mOsmol/L was seen, with 22 (out of 32) jockeys classed as dehydrated (>700 mOsmols/L), indicating that body mass would be higher when euhydrated. Additionally, we observed that within new apprentice jockeys licensed during this study (N = 41), only one jockey was able to achieve the minimum weight. To facilitate the goal of achieving race weight with minimal disruptions to well-being, the authors’ data suggest that the minimum weight for GB apprentices should be raised.

ABSTRACT: The aim of this study was to describe the causes of death in Thoroughbred horses at the Racetrack “La Rinconada”, in Caracas (Venezuela) during 2008-2012. This study was conducted in a cohort of all Thoroughbred horses that died or were subjected to euthanasia. Data was collected retrospectively. Only horses for which a full necropsy report was available were included in the study. The carcass and all internal organs of each horse were examined and representative samples of tissues with abnormalities were collected in 10% neutral buffered formalin and processed for histopathological examination. Samples were collected for bacteriological or virological examination when indicated in gross examination. A descriptive statistical analysis was performed. A total of 532 Thoroughbred horses were examined post-mortem. Of these horses, 44% were females and 56% males. In general musculoskeletal injuries and dilaceration occurred specifically at higher frequency. The total year and horses dead for descriptive statistical analysis was to mean 106.4 and median 125; Standard Deviation: 47.82573; variation (Standard Deviation): 2287.3, population (Standard Deviation): 42.77663 and variance (Standard Deviation): 18229.84. In conclusion we identify and describe the causes of death in Thoroughbred Race Horses in Caracas, Venezuela. In order of importance the causes of death were principally skeletal muscle injuries resulting in fractures euthanasia, abdominal crisis were mostly bowel twists and gastric rupture andrespiratory pathologies such as the pneumonia, pleuritis presented a significant number of cases of pulmonary hemorrhage induced by exercise. Finally the multisystem pathologies were presented in low cases.

Abstract Background Prevalence of CRKP bloodstream infection with high mortality has attached physicians' attention. High-VAT and high-SAT were confirmed by previous studies that closely related to increased pneumonia severity, more complications, and higher mortality in COVID-19. Thus, we speculate that CT-quantified body composition may also be connected to all-cause mortality and bacterial clearance in patients with CRKP bloodstream infection. Methods We investigated the associations of CT-quantified body composition with CRKP bloodstream infectious patients. All of the CT images were obtained at the level of the L3/4 spinal level. The prognostic value of the body composition was analyzed using the Cox regression model, and precise clinical nomograms were established. Results Factors associated with 30-day all-in hospital mortality included TAT [adjusted odds ratio (OR) = 1.028, 95% confidence interval (CI), 1.004–1.053; p = 0.028], age [OR = 1.031, 95% CI, 1.001–1.062; p = 0.046] and SOFA score [OR = 1.137, 95% CI 1.047–1.235; p = 0.002]. Compared with low-VAT, patients with high-VAT show a strikingly poor prognosis in both 30-day mortality (P = 0.0449, Fig. 2A) and all-cause mortality (P = 0.0048, Fig. 2C). The results of TAT were similar with VAT. Conclusions Our study suggests that CT-derived composition could be a credible and effective alternative to assess the prognosis of patients with BSIs owing to CRKP. CT-quantified total adipose tissue, age and SOFA scores were independently associated with 30-day all-cause mortality in these severe infectious patients, while skeletal muscle did not have obvious statistical significance.
